Talking teats teased by child's Oreo cookies

We'll sign off this week with this lovely commercial featuring a set of moaning, frustrated udders that are craving Oreo cookies about as badly as you're craving that happy-hour cocktail. Courtesy of Draftfcb, which always has such a way with animals.
